Red Velvet Cookies

Red velvet cookies with cake mix and white chocolate chips are a simple 4-ingredient dessert for Valentine’s Day.

Ingredients

  • 1 15.25 ounce box red velvet cake mix
  • ½ cup vegetable or canola oil
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up white chocolate chips

Instructions

  • Add the cake mix, oil, and eggs to a large mixing bowl.
  • Beat on low speed until well blended, about one minute.
  • Add the chocolate chips and use a spatula to fold them into the cookie dough.
  • Refrigerate for 1 hour (or up to 2 days).
  • Preheat the oven to 350ºF. Line two baking sheets with baking parchment.
  • Scoop out the cookie dough onto the baking sheets (about two heaped tablespoons of dough per cookie).
  • Leave some space in-between each cookie as they will spread during baking.
  • Bake in the center of the pre-heated oven for 10 minutes.
  • Remove from the oven and leave to cool on the baking tray for 10 minutes then transfer to a wire rack to cool.
